Not following the kit's instructions exactly is one of the biggest mistakes you can make, but it's also one of the easiest to avoid. Every step, from collecting samples to shipping them, is designed to ensure that your results are accurate and reliable. If you skip a step or take a shortcut, you could contaminate the sample or obtain meaningless data, which would render the entire test less valid.
How to avoid it: Read the whole instruction manual before you start. Put all the kit parts on a table and learn how to use them. Do each step in the order that is given. Pay close attention to details such as how to use the collection tools, the number of samples required, and the correct sealing procedure for the container. You can avoid having to retake the test by taking an extra five minutes to get ready.
The things you do every day have a direct effect on your gut microbiome. The kit typically includes instructions on what to eat, drink, or avoid in the days leading up to sample collection. Many people ignore these suggestions and continue with their usual behavior, which can alter the results. For instance, adding a new food or taking some supplements right before the test can change the bacteria in your gut for a short time, giving you a picture that isn’t typical of your usual state.
How to avoid it: Follow all the rules exactly before the test. If the kit instructs you to avoid probiotics, alcohol, or certain high-fiber foods for a few days, follow this advice. The goal is to provide a sample that represents the average health of your gut, rather than how it changes over time. This ensures that the advice you receive is based on what you truly need in the long run.
The Gut Health Kit is more than just a test; it typically comes with supplements or probiotics designed to support your microbiome. One common mistake is not taking these supplements every day. Taking the wrong amount or using them at inconsistent times each day can reduce their effectiveness. To colonize your gut and have a positive effect, good bacteria and nutrients must be present consistently.
How to avoid it: Make your supplement routine a daily habit that you stick to. You can set a recurring alarm on your phone or connect it to an activity you already do, such as brushing your teeth or eating breakfast. To get the health results you want, you need to be consistent with rebalancing your gut flora. If you forget to take a dose, don't take two; instead, take the next one at the scheduled time.
Getting your gut health back to normal takes time, not a quick fix. Many people give up when they don't see a significant difference in the first few days or weeks. Over the years, your gut microbiome has become a complex ecosystem. It takes time for good bacteria to establish themselves and for inflammation to subside.
How to avoid it: Be patient and manage your expectations. It may take weeks or even months to notice significant improvements in your digestion, energy levels, or skin clarity. Stick to the program's advice and trust the process. Keeping a journal of your symptoms can help you see small, gradual changes over time.
The Gut Health Kit offers some excellent tools, but it's not a magic solution. People often make the mistake of only using the kit's supplements and not making changes to their daily lives to support them. A poor diet, prolonged stress, insufficient sleep, and inadequate physical activity can all compromise your gut health and reduce the effectiveness of the kit.
How to avoid it: Consider the Gut Health Kit as a starting point for larger changes. Make smart changes to your daily life based on what you learned from your test results. Eat more whole foods, fiber, and foods that have been fermented. Prioritize stress-reduction methods, such as yoga or meditation. Get 7 to 9 hours of quality sleep each night and exercise regularly. These habits work in conjunction with the kit to achieve long-term health improvements.

What should I do if I get gas or bloating when I start the kit?
It's normal for your gut microbiome to change, and mild bloating or gas can happen. This usually resolves on its own within one to two weeks. Make sure to drink plenty of water, and consider starting with a half dose for a few days to allow your body to adjust more gradually. If the symptoms persist or worsen, consult a doctor.
